Transaction 32af99958210686e14f2c929603cf3f00eb0b3befd05e7d1f77343b1442ff56b

1 Input
2 Outputs
  • 32af99958210686e14f2c929603cf3f00eb0b3befd05e7d1f77343b1442ff56b:0
  • value  345611
    address  1EdsYNLfUrAd2ZAiGLpaL25Lg1GNuDT8kY
  • 32af99958210686e14f2c929603cf3f00eb0b3befd05e7d1f77343b1442ff56b:1
  • value  84742056
    address  1gvaAKH9DTY6JNPucLZBAnuUrUbVCNDU2